SA 968. Mr. WYDEN (for himself, Mr. Schumer, Mr. Brown, Mr. Casey,
Mr. Durbin, and Mrs. Murray) submitted an amendment intended to be
proposed by him to the concurrent resolution S. Con. Res. 11, setting
forth the congressional budget for the United States Government for
fiscal year 2016 and setting forth the appropriate budgetary levels for
fiscal years 2017 through 2025; as follows:
At the appropriate place, insert the following:
SEC. ___. DEFICIT-NEUTRAL RESERVE FUND RELATING TO MIDDLE
CLASS TAX RELIEF.
The Chairman of the Committee on the Budget of the Senate
may revise the allocations of a committee or committees,
aggregates, and other appropriate levels in this resolution
for one or more bills, joint resolutions, amendments,
amendments between the Houses, motions, or conference reports
relating to extending and expanding refundable tax provisions
that benefit working families, childless workers, and the
middle class, by the amounts provided in such legislation for
those purposes, provided that such legislation would not
increase the deficit over either the period of the total of
fiscal years 2016 through 2020 or the period of the total of
fiscal years 2016 through 2025.
